Abstract
The nonlinear coupled-mode equation base on signal wave and idler wave, the parametric amplification gain coefficient , the signal wave amplification factor and the idler wave conversion efficiency have been obtained about double pumped parametric amplification. The parametric amplification gain coefficient , the signal wave amplification factor and the idler wave conversion efficiency have been studied and numerical simulation only to change the double-pump power ratio of s = P1 /P2 when the total input pump power remains unchanged. The results show that signal wave amplification and idler wave can been obtained by changes double pumped power ratio values under phase matching.关键词
